About Accounting & Auditing Law in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nam

Accounting and auditing laws in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nam, are regulated by national standards and local legislation. The country places significant emphasis on maintaining transparency and fairness in financial reporting and audits to foster investor confidence and economic growth. The Ministry of Finance oversees these areas, ensuring adherence to the Law on Accounting, Law on Independent Audit, and relevant decrees and circulars that provide guidelines on compliance, ethics, and professional standards.

Local Laws Overview

The legal framework for accounting and auditing in Ho Chi Minh City is embedded in several key laws:

  • Law on Accounting (2015): This law provides the foundation for accounting standards and principles, emphasizing transparency and truthful representation of financial status.
  • Law on Independent Audit (2011): It outlines the roles and responsibilities of auditing firms, ensuring audits are objective, fair, and compliant with set standards.
  • Regulatory Decrees and Circulars: These provide detailed guidance and updates on accounting practices, audit processes, and financial reporting requirements.

Companies operating in Ho Chi Minh City must adhere to these regulations to ensure compliance and avoid potential penalties.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the role of the Ministry of Finance in accounting and auditing in Ho Chi Minh City?

The Ministry of Finance in Vietnam regulates accounting and auditing practices, issuing standards and guidelines to ensure transparency and compliance throughout the country, including Ho Chi Minh City.

Are international accounting standards applicable in Vietnam?

While Vietnam has its own set of accounting standards, known as Vietnamese Accounting Standards (VAS), efforts are being made to harmonize these with International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S).

What are the consequences of non-compliance with accounting laws in Ho Chi Minh City?

Non-compliance can result in administrative penalties, fines, and in severe cases, criminal charges, which can severely affect a business's operations and reputation.

How often are businesses required to be audited in Vietnam?

Typically, most companies in Vietnam are required to undergo an annual audit, but the frequency may depend on the company's nature and size.

Can foreign businesses operate under different accounting standards in Vietnam?

Foreign businesses must comply with Vietnamese accounting standards, although they can keep additional records according to international standards for their internal purposes.

Who can conduct audits in Vietnam?

Only audit firms and auditors licensed by the Ministry of Finance are permitted to conduct audits in Vietnam.

What types of financial statements are companies required to prepare?

Companies are generally required to prepare balance sheets, income statements, cash flow statements, and notes to financial statements.

How does one handle a dispute with an auditor?

Disputes should first be addressed through internal discussions. If unresolved, legal counsel can assist in mediating or resolving the disagreement.

Are electronic records acceptable for auditing purposes?

Yes, electronic records are recognized, provided they meet specific standards and integrity requirements set by Vietnamese law.

What should a company expect during an audit process?

An audit will typically involve a detailed examination of financial records, discussions with management, and assessments of compliance with applicable accounting standards and laws.
